      Opened up a package of HHB from "Half Eye" last week and there was a PVC tube inside with a bonus!
Rich sent me an "Eastern Two Fletch" made from Wild Rose, Turkey feathers and Dan Hamblin point tied on with deer sinew. I love the character of this shaft, it's snakey but it's straight overall... ;)  This is a hunt worthy arrow and will be in my quiver this fall, hopefully adding some medicine to my hunts...

Also, don't test it in that target toooooo much unless you know how to resharpen the edges. Don't wana hunt with a dull point. I put little strips of masking tape over the cutting edges to test mine.
